根据对其他列的查找来填充数据框列的方法有多种,以下是其中几种常见的方法:
- 使用条件语句:可以使用条件语句(如if-else语句)来根据其他列的值进行判断并填充目标列。根据不同的条件,可以使用不同的数值或字符串来填充目标列。
- 使用函数:可以使用函数来根据其他列的值进行计算并填充目标列。例如,可以使用数学函数、字符串函数或自定义函数来根据其他列的值进行计算并填充目标列。
- 使用映射表:可以创建一个映射表,将其他列的值与目标列的值进行映射关系,并根据映射表来填充目标列。映射表可以是一个字典、数据框或数据库表。
- 使用聚合函数:如果需要根据其他列的汇总信息来填充目标列,可以使用聚合函数(如sum、mean、max等)来计算其他列的汇总值,并将该值填充到目标列中。
- 使用机器学习模型:如果数据量较大且复杂,可以使用机器学习模型来预测目标列的值。可以使用监督学习算法(如回归、分类等)来训练模型,并根据其他列的值进行预测并填充目标列。
对于以上方法,腾讯云提供了多个相关产品和服务,如:
- 数据库:腾讯云数据库(TencentDB)提供了多种类型的数据库,包括关系型数据库(MySQL、SQL Server等)和非关系型数据库(MongoDB、Redis等),可以用于存储和管理数据。
- 人工智能:腾讯云人工智能(AI)平台提供了多个人工智能服务,如图像识别、语音识别、自然语言处理等,可以用于处理和分析数据。
- 云原生:腾讯云容器服务(TKE)提供了容器化部署和管理的解决方案,可以用于构建和运行云原生应用。
- 移动开发:腾讯云移动开发套件(Mobile Developer Kit)提供了移动应用开发的工具和服务,可以用于开发和管理移动应用。
以上是一些常见的方法和相关产品,具体选择哪种方法和产品取决于具体的需求和场景。